Meditation Instructions for Sun., October 18, 2015

For this Sunday, October 18th, the focus for our meditation will be on Darkness.  I always find such profound meaning in the writings of Father Richard Rohr, a Franciscan friar, who wrote, “There are two wildernesses, two Darknesses in the spiritual journey. One you go into by your own stupidity, by your sin, blindness, ignorance and mistakes. We all do that. But there’s another Darkness. The holy Darkness is the Darkness that God leads us into, through and beyond. This is a necessary Darkness for the journey. In a certain sense, God’s Darkness is a much better teacher than light. There comes a time when you have to either go deeper into faith or you will turn back, when you have to live without knowing or you lose faith altogether.”  Without Darkness most of us would not achieve the developmental progress we do in this life, for it is the Darkness that often compels us to make difficult decisions and change.  If we were not forcefully prodded to enter the Dark tunnels we all find ourselves in from time to time how would we ever have discovered the light that exists at the other end?  It is the hopeful exploration driven by our blindness in the Dark that allows us to plumb the depths of our beliefs and discover just how resilient our faith can be.  Such periods of Darkness can lead to an even stronger sense of faith and connection to God that fortify our foundation to the core and allow us to emerge a better person on the other end.  This week in our prayer and meditation let us consider whether there are Dark places in our life into which we have been afraid to venture.  Let us ask to be shown how to enter those periods of Darkness that we all encounter in our life with hope and faith and ask to be guided by Spirit in a way that helps see us through to the other end, victorious.
